Accelerated Bachelor’s to Master’s: Mathematics, specialization in Statistics

Criteria and Application Requirements

Students interested in pursuing the Accelerated Bachelor of Science in Statistics to Master of Arts in Mathematics with specialization in Statistics must:

  1. Be pursuing Bachelor of Science in Statistics
  2. By the start of the student’s Accelerated status, have either:
    • 75 credit hours earned and an overall BGSU GPA of at least 3.2, or
    • 90 credit hours earned and an overall BGSU GPA of at least 3.0;
  3. Complete Accelerated Bachelor’s to Master’s Program Application;
  4. Submit transcripts from all universities attended;
  5. Submit at least two letters of recommendation from graduate faculty in the Department of Mathematics and Statistics at BGSU.
  6. Submit a Statement of Purpose describing how the Master’s in Mathematics with specialization in Statistics aligns with the applicants professional objectives.

Once the student completes their undergraduate degree, they should complete the remaining requirements for the Master of Arts in Mathematics with specialization in Statistics program.

Note:  In order to be considered for teaching assistantships and tuition scholarships, a student in the accelerated program must submit a new statement of purpose and an updated copy of their unofficial transcripts on or before January 15th of the year when the student begins his/hers master’s program.
